    Understanding Red Flags

    To truly grasp the concept of a red flag, particularly one emblazoned with a symbolic black bird, we need to delve into its deeper meaning. A red flag, in its simplest form, is a warning sign. It's an indicator that something is not right, that a situation might be heading toward trouble, or that a person's behavior is cause for concern. These flags can manifest in countless ways, from subtle inconsistencies in someone's story to glaring contradictions between their words and actions.

    The scientific foundation for recognizing red flags lies in our innate ability to detect anomalies. Human brains are wired to identify patterns and deviations from those patterns. When something doesn't align with our expectations or experiences, it triggers an alert system, prompting us to investigate further. This system is based on a combination of cognitive processes, including pattern recognition, emotional intelligence, and critical thinking.

    Historically, the concept of a red flag has been used in various contexts to signal danger. In maritime history, a red flag hoisted on a ship indicated that it was carrying a contagious disease. In motorsports, a red flag signals an immediate halt to the race due to hazardous conditions. These literal uses of the red flag highlight its primary function: to warn of immediate or potential harm.

    Essential concepts related to red flags include:

    • Intuition: The gut feeling that something is wrong, even if you can't articulate why.
    • Boundary Violations: Actions that disregard personal limits and disrespect individual autonomy.
    • Gaslighting: A manipulative tactic used to make someone question their sanity or perception of reality.
    • Inconsistency: Discrepancies between words and actions, or conflicting narratives.
    • Control: Attempts to dominate or manipulate another person's behavior.

    Recognizing these concepts is crucial for identifying red flags early on. It allows us to move beyond superficial observations and understand the underlying dynamics at play.     Tips and Expert Advice

    Identifying and addressing red flags requires a combination of self-awareness, critical thinking, and effective communication. Here are some practical tips and expert advice to help you navigate these challenging situations:

    1. Trust Your Intuition: Your gut feeling is often the first indicator that something is wrong. Don't dismiss your intuition, even if you can't immediately explain why you feel uneasy. Pay attention to those subtle signals and investigate further. Remember, the red flag with a black bird often begins as a faint whisper of unease.

    2. Observe Patterns of Behavior: Look for recurring patterns in a person's behavior rather than focusing on isolated incidents. Consistency is key. If someone consistently exhibits controlling tendencies, disregards your boundaries, or avoids accountability, it's a significant red flag.

    3. Communicate Clearly: Express your concerns directly and assertively. Use "I" statements to communicate how their behavior affects you. For example, "I feel uncomfortable when you check my phone without asking." Clear communication can help address misunderstandings and prevent further boundary violations. If the other person becomes defensive or dismissive, it's another red flag.

    4. Set Healthy Boundaries: Define your personal limits and communicate them clearly to others. Boundaries are essential for maintaining healthy relationships and protecting your emotional well-being. Be prepared to enforce your boundaries if they are violated. This might mean limiting contact, ending a relationship, or seeking legal protection.

    5. Seek External Perspectives: Talk to trusted friends, family members, or a therapist about your concerns. An outside perspective can provide valuable insights and help you see the situation more objectively. Sometimes, it's difficult to recognize red flags when you're too close to the situation.

    6. Document Everything: Keep a record of concerning incidents, conversations, and behaviors. This documentation can be helpful if you need to seek legal or professional assistance in the future. It can also serve as a reminder of why you made certain decisions.

    7. Be Prepared to Walk Away: Sometimes, the healthiest course of action is to remove yourself from a toxic situation. If you've tried to address the red flags and the behavior persists, it might be time to end the relationship or leave the job. Your well-being is paramount. Recognizing that the red flag with a black bird signifies an irredeemable situation is crucial for self-preservation.

    8. Practice Self-Care: Dealing with red flags can be emotionally draining. Prioritize self-care activities that help you relax, recharge, and maintain your mental health. This might include exercise, meditation, spending time in nature, or engaging in hobbies you enjoy.

    FAQ

    • Q: What's the difference between a red flag and a personal preference?

      • A: Red flags are indicators of potentially harmful or unhealthy behavior, while personal preferences are simply things you like or dislike. Red flags often involve disrespect, manipulation, or disregard for boundaries, whereas preferences are subjective and don't necessarily indicate a problem.
    • Q: Can someone change after exhibiting red flag behavior?

      • A: While it's possible for people to change, it requires genuine self-awareness, a willingness to take responsibility for their actions, and a commitment to therapy or personal growth. However, relying on someone to change is risky. It's important to prioritize your own well-being and set boundaries regardless of their potential for change.
    • Q: How do I avoid ignoring red flags?

      • A: Practice self-awareness, trust your intuition, and seek external perspectives. Educate yourself about common red flags and be willing to confront uncomfortable truths. Remember that ignoring red flags can have serious consequences.
    • Q: What if I'm unsure whether something is a red flag or not?

      • A: Err on the side of caution. If you're unsure, talk to a trusted friend, family member, or therapist. It's better to address a potential problem early on than to ignore it and risk further harm.
    • Q: Is it possible to have too many red flags?

      • A: While it's important to be discerning, being overly critical or suspicious can also be detrimental. Strive for a balanced approach, focusing on objective observations and patterns of behavior rather than letting paranoia dictate your perceptions.
